The amount of potential vectors out there are massively increasing,\u201d says Vinit Duggal, Chief Information Security Officer (CISO) at Intelsat, which has seen a 60 percent increase in the number of DDoS attacks from 2015 to 2016.<\/p>\n<p>While those attacks were unsuccessful, they still signal a dramatic jump in these kinds of threats, especially as the industry moves more toward IP infrastructure, hybrid networks and cloud-based solutions.<\/p>\n<p>Duggal says that the amount of high-throughput satellites and consumption occurring on mobile devices and connected devices has caused the threat landscape to get \u201cexponentially bigger.\u201d<\/p>\n<p>\u201cNow you are dealing with ensuring security across all the different components that enable the entire ecosystem and that obviously hasn\u2019t been done effectively to date. All these components have the potential to contain vulnerabilities,\u201d he adds.<\/p>\n<p>Duggal also notes that more advanced threats from the ground are using trusted ports and communication streams, underscoring the need for having the appropriate visibility, teams at the ready and partnerships in place to respond quickly.<\/p>\n<p>\u201cIt\u2019s a big issue. We face attacks originating from individuals, from groups and from nation states,\u201d adds Dave Henning, director of network security at Hughes. In his 12 years at Hughes, Henning has gone from helping work on security features of Hughes\u2019 first satellite, Spaceway, to overseeing the security operations team that monitors for threats.<\/p>\n<p>\u201cThe speed by which technology changes is the tough part to keep up with, especially when you are dealing with things in space that are designed to be in orbit for 15 years,\u201d Henning says. \u201cYou have to be very forward thinking in how you are going to protect those assets, knowing that the attackers are going to be faster with the pace of technology advances.\u201d<\/p>\n<h2>A Growing Threat<\/h2>\n<p>Ransomware, which encrypts all the files on a computer until a person or company pays a \u201cransom,\u201d is one of the fastest-growing threats. It renders any network vulnerable, especially if the network operator does not have proper anti-ransomware cybersecurity protocols in effect. This form of cybercrime cost victims $250 million in the first quarter of 2016. You have to be five steps ahead,\u201d warns Ron Clifton, president and founder of CliftonGroup International, and a frequent adviser to companies on cybersecurity strategy. \u201cOne of the biggest challenges we have is awareness of the threats and being able to do a proper threat and vulnerability analysis so you understand what the threats are.\u201d<\/p>\n<p>But Clifton says cybersecurity awareness within the industry is growing, evident by the level of industry engagement and the number of conferences focused on the issue. \u201cI don\u2019t think the industry was taking it very seriously two or three years ago, but now momentum is growing like crazy,\u201d he says.<\/p>\n<p>The Obama Administration made it a priority, launching the National Cybersecurity Action Plan in 2013 and calling for $19 billion in the FY17 budget, an increase of 35 percent over the previous fiscal year. In addition, the Federal Communications Commission (FCC) formed a working group specifically to look at critical communications and security. Clifton says a key result of the Cybersecurity Risk Management and Best Practices working group was endorsing the National Institute of Standards and Technology (NIST) cybersecurity framework for the communications sector. It also included specific guidance and resources for various segments of U.S. critical infrastructure, including the satellite industry.<\/p>\n<p>\u201cThe framework offers voluntary guidelines to help companies strengthen their resiliency. It has five core categories for protection, with links to very detailed standards such as ISO 27001\/27002 and the [Center for Internet Security] CIS Critical Security Controls (CSCs),\u201d says Clifton, explaining that major satellite manufacturers concerned about their ground systems or air assets would want to follow the more rigorous International Organization for Standardization (ISO) standards whereas the CIS CSCs would be more applicable to service providers and vendors.<\/p>\n<p>Clifton emphasizes the importance of having a risk management framework \u2014 \u201cif you don\u2019t have one you are wasting your time and money,\u201d he says.<\/p>\n<h2>Rethinking Networks, Products<\/h2>\n<p>Industry leaders say that the increases in attacks on networks have forced them to rethink how they build products and what solutions they offer to their customers who are looking for additional security capabilities.<\/p>\n<p>\u201cOne thing the threat environment has created is the need for network protections against cyber threats at the design phase. We\u2019ve gone to an iterative process to build our products such that we can insert value at any time during our release cycle,\u201d says Andy Tomaszewski, chief security officer at iDirect.<\/p>\n<p>iDirect helped develop GVF\u2019s Product Security Baseline, designed for organizations that develop and produce VSAT hardware and software. Tomaszewski started a product security group within iDirect where he collaborates closely with engineering and product teams to continuously look at new threat information coming in so they can constantly find ways to enhance the security of their products. \u201cFor every major release we have security engineers break down our product and show us what needs to be corrected,\u201d he says.<\/p>\n<p>iDirect\u2019s goal is to make sure its products \u201care properly hardened\u201d and can integrate with other vendors\u2019 technologies, so they can be as flexible as possible for their customers who face very specific threats depending on their industry, Tomaszewski explains.<\/p>\n<p><script>var AIAD_fcd45f981d570e35cee941b23edc69c7_6a6aa70c875f1;googletag.cmd.push(function(){var AIMAP_29b58f13885ebf8ea6b032f958eb0748 = googletag.sizeMapping().addSize([992, 100], [[970, 90], [970, 250]]).addSize([768, 100], [728, 90]).addSize([320, 100], [320, 50]).build();var AIMAP_737ce075cc05dd766c8f8ea08f3faa73 = googletag.sizeMapping().addSize([768, 100], [728, 90]).addSize([320, 100], [320, 50]).build();var AIMAP_21fe3bcfb86a8660aba4e721ee9338f3 = googletag.sizeMapping().addSize([1200, 100], [970, 250]).addSize([768, 100], [600, 300]).addSize([320, 100], [300, 250]).build();AIAD_fcd45f981d570e35cee941b23edc69c7_6a6aa70c875f1 = googletag.defineSlot('\/987\/satellitetoday.com\/via-satellite-digital-issue-ads', [ [600, 300], [300, 250], [970, 250] ], 'div-gpt-ad-1774631144891- 0-6a6aa70c875f2').defineSizeMapping(AIMAP_21fe3bcfb86a8660aba4e721ee9338f3).setCollapseEmptyDiv(true).addService(googletag.pubads());   });<\/script><script>googletag.cmd.push(function() { googletag.display('div-gpt-ad-1774631144891- 0-6a6aa70c875f2'); });<\/script><\/p>\n<p>According to Duggal, Intelsat thinks security first. \u201cIt is ingrained in our DNA,\u201d he says. The company uses an internal security team and external third parties to evaluate their security posture. Duggal says Intelsat has a Service Organizational Control (SOC3) accreditation that is awarded annually after a detailed audit of the operator\u2019s satellite and terrestrial service environments.<\/p>\n<p>DataPath applied its decades-long experience developing networks for high-security government and military environments to offer commercial customers Managed Security Services (MSS) a little over a year ago.<\/p>\n<p>\u201cWe built out our cybersecurity operations center and through that we are offering 24\/7 managed security services to our customers, which involves watching their networks for any threats,\u201d notes Peggy Rowe, VP of software and cyber solutions at DataPath.<\/p>\n<p>The company works with channel partners and direct customers to provide vulnerability assessments, penetration testing, security device management, 24\/7 monitoring of networks for threats and incident response.<\/p>\n<p>Rowe says lately managers on sales calls often spend more time answering questions about DataPath\u2019s managed security services than the company\u2019s hardware products. \u201cCyber and protecting networks and systems is becoming part of the conversation,\u201d Rowe says.<\/p>\n<p>On the broadcast side of the sector, International Datacasting Corporation (IDC), based in Ottawa, offers content and data protection, leveraging encryption and firewalls to safeguard broadcasting clients from malicious viruses and other threats that could cause someone to hijack or interfere with a broadcast transmission. One of the company\u2019s biggest encryption clients is the U.S. government.<\/p>\n<p>\u201cIt\u2019s all manageable but you have to be vigilant in a way you didn\u2019t have to before,\u201d says Diana Cantu, VP of marketing and sales at IDC. As the broadcasting industry migrates more and more to IP, the need for protected networks increases. The biggest challenge for broadcasters, says Cantu, is \u201ccalibrating the threat and understanding the tradeoffs.\u201d<\/p>\n<p>\u201cThis isn\u2019t virus protection; it\u2019s understanding what the real threat is and what the best practices are. It\u2019s good we are starting to have standards; I am confident that with the standards body, the broadcasting industry will be able to start incorporating these practices. It\u2019s really critical that the industry stay with open standards. To me, that\u2019s the biggest challenge \u2014 no one wants to go back to the dark ages where everybody had a proprietary network.\u201d<\/p>\n<h2>More Information Sharing Needed<\/h2>\n<p>Looking forward, some industry insiders think the industry needs to be more open about sharing what they know to combat today\u2019s cyber threats. \u201cInformation sharing between companies in our industry is still in its infancy,\u201d observes Intelsat\u2019s Duggal, who says there is much more transparent exchanges within the traditional terrestrial and wireless sectors. \u201cIt makes everybody better \u2014 it would make us better,\u201d he adds.<\/p>\n<p><script>var AIAD_fcd45f981d570e35cee941b23edc69c7_6a6aa70c87add;googletag.cmd.push(function(){var AIMAP_29b58f13885ebf8ea6b032f958eb0748 = googletag.sizeMapping().addSize([992, 100], [[970, 90], [970, 250]]).addSize([768, 100], [728, 90]).addSize([320, 100], [320, 50]).build();var AIMAP_737ce075cc05dd766c8f8ea08f3faa73 = googletag.sizeMapping().addSize([768, 100], [728, 90]).addSize([320, 100], [320, 50]).build();var AIMAP_21fe3bcfb86a8660aba4e721ee9338f3 = googletag.sizeMapping().addSize([1200, 100], [970, 250]).addSize([768, 100], [600, 300]).addSize([320, 100], [300, 250]).build();AIAD_fcd45f981d570e35cee941b23edc69c7_6a6aa70c87add = googletag.defineSlot('\/987\/satellitetoday.com\/via-satellite-digital-issue-ads', [ [600, 300], [300, 250], [970, 250] ], 'div-gpt-ad-1774631144891- 0-6a6aa70c87ade').defineSizeMapping(AIMAP_21fe3bcfb86a8660aba4e721ee9338f3).setCollapseEmptyDiv(true).addService(googletag.pubads());   });<\/script><script>googletag.cmd.push(function() { googletag.display('div-gpt-ad-1774631144891- 0-6a6aa70c87ade'); });<\/script><\/p>\n<p>iDirect\u2019s Tomaszewski agrees. \u201cThe more we work together to talk about the threat actors, the better we can move the industry forward.\u201d He anticipates that in the next year to five years, the industry will operate extremely adaptive networks, frequently updated and changed to counteract the threat of the day.<\/p>\n<p>\u201cThat\u2019s where we need to be \u2014 able to update or upgrade on a very rapid basis without jeopardizing the resiliency of our environment,\u201d Tomaszewski says.<\/p>\n<p>Cantu says the most important next step is acknowledging that the cybersecurity threat \u201cis very real\u201d and then to put a plan into place to address it. The need has intensified with the growth in cybersecurity threats hitting the industry.<\/p>\n<p>Matthew Broida, VP of marketing and technology at Harris CapRock, has seen \u201ca real uptick\u201d in cybersecurity incidents over the last two to three years with CapRock customer segments, especially in the energy arena. He recalls how one rig was so infected with malware it took weeks to reverse the incident.<\/p>\n<p>\u201cThe industry has even seen cases where relatively low-tech cyber criminals such as Somali pirates used GPS to track fleets to help guide their hijackers,\u201d he adds.<\/p>\n<p>In March Harris CapRock unveiled its SafePass Pro to provide proactive defense against cyberattacks targeting oil and gas IT infrastructures. The company has followed GVF guidelines for cybersecurity testing and protocols. CapRock has had its network audited using GVF standards, adding new processes and new security practices where needed.<\/p>\n<p>Broida predicts cybersecurity solutions will soon be the industry norm for major satellite companies. \u201cYou are going to start to see large operators \u2014 the Shell\u2019s and the Exxon\u2019s of the world \u2014 make cybersecurity part of their [Request for Proposals] RFPs and even possibly annual or biannual cybersecurity audits,\u201d he says.<\/p>\n<p>Broida says that satellite firms unable to demonstrate that they have a secure network may eventually be forced into \u201cvery commoditized\u201d roles in the industry. \u201cOur end customers also believe that cybersecurity can be a differentiator for them in the sense that a Shell or Exxon is more likely to pick a rig that has advanced cybersecurity than an asset with another company that might struggle to do so,\u201d he adds.<\/p>\n<p>Harris CapRock\u2019s investments in network resiliency
